The Glasgow Coma Scale (GCS) is the global gold standard for evaluating a patient's level of consciousness. By scoring responses across Eye, Verbal, and Motor categories, clinicians can objectively document neurological status and track changes over time. How it Works

The tool sums the best response from each of the three clinical categories. It then maps this total to a severity classification based on established neurosurgical guidelines.

Calculation Formula

GCS = E + V + M

Calculation Examples

1. **Conscious**: Spontaneous (4), Oriented (5), Obeys (6) = **15**. 2. **Critical**: Pain (2), Incomprehensible (2), Decerebrate (2) = **6**.
